Output 82f751c64ca401ff22854c571538ca613edce577c773b1bb60062d2c6e94e56b:3

value
34205185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c405bb2c31cc0c1df8d09e78af2745869d72e6 OP_EQUAL
address
3JzQTg3Q9JPzbnJxYpwJp8bMaAaeQ9XyDY
transaction
82f751c64ca401ff22854c571538ca613edce577c773b1bb60062d2c6e94e56b
spent
true